just a quickie folks....

woke up on thursday morning to the sound of trickling from the tank:unsure: and upon arriving downstairs found aprox 100ltrs of nice warm smelly water on the front room carpet!!!!!
after having a good look round the filter (including pipes)and tank itself i found the non return valve had come off from the airline and...... guess the rest:blink:
im so careful to check the filters lights fish and parameters but overlooked this damn little pipe.
give yours a check will ya:woohoo:

Hi Suckers,
sorry to hear that not what you want at all! it is as you say very important to check equipment regularly a few minutes each day can save hours and cash.
When it comes to air line check valve i try to position them with in the tank well above the water line thus if it disconnects the line fall into the tank with no water escaping.
and yes i learned this the hard way! I would also suggest that you have airline clamps on for any occasion you need to turn off the air pump as precaution and of course replace valve regularly 12 months min and replace air line and valve at least every three years for best results.
